Vanadinite is a mineral belonging to the apatite group of phosphates, with the chemical formula Pb₅(VO₄)₃Cl. It is one of the main industrial ores of the metal vanadium and a minor source of lead. Crystal class: Dipyramidal (6/m); H-M symbol: (6/m)
Crystal system: Hexagonal
Crystal habit: Prismatic or nodular; may be acicular, hairlike, fibrous; rarely rounded, globular
Formula mass: 1416.27 g/mol
Optical properties: Uniaxial (-)
Mohs scale hardness: 3–4
Space group: P63/m
